Kara Leigh Calvin Jones, 23, left her earthly home April 23, 2006, in Mannford, OK.
Kara was born April 21, 1983, into the marriage of Wendall and Teresa Calvin. She lived in the Columbia area until her marriage to Gary Jones.
She spent her school years at Midway Elementary School, Smithton Middle School, West Junior High School, Hickman High School and Linn State Technical College. She was pursuing a career in the automotive field. Her hobbies included Nascar art and poetry.
She was preceded in death by her grandfathers, Earl Leeroy Calvin and Kenneth Lee(1924 - 1996), and grandmother Sally Davenport and great-grandfather Leroy Massey(1922 - 1943) .
She is survived by her husband, Gary Jones; parents David and Teresa Carlos; brother Justin Carlos; parents Wendall and Lisa Calvin; siblings Lauren, Rusty and Tyler Calvin; grandparents Karon and James Rush, Kathryn Calvin Lee, Ed and Linda Carlos, and  Timothy Griffith(1942 - 2009) ; great-grandmother Doris Rolle(1921 - 2010) ; and numerous other family members.
Although Kara's time with us was brief, she lives on in the hearts of all of those she touched.
Visitation will be April 27, at Memorial Funeral Home. Services will be Friday at Midway Locust Grove United Methodist Church in Midway, with internment following at Locust Grove Cemetery in Midway.
COLUMBIA (MO) DAILY TRIBUNE, 26/Apr/2006
